前言

很多老哥都对我为啥使用OpenVZ抱有疑问,那么我为啥使用OVZ呢?肯定是因为方便啊,我这么个良心老板怎么会超开呢。
所以下面我来详细说明下SolusVM配置NAT小鸡的方法与排坑秘籍。

材料

  • 千年老母鸡一只
  • 完整的挨批v4一个(5353、5656、443、10010-12549、61001-61254端口必须)
  • Centos 6系统(只有Centos6可以 别问为什么 试了一堆系统试出来的)
  • 脑子 脑子 脑子
    材料就是这么简单,最重要的是带着脑子……

443端口并非必须

安装

第一步-基本环境

于SSH执行如下命令

yum install wget -y
wget https://files.soluslabs.com/install.sh
sh install.sh

然后等待脚本预配置,进入如下界面后选择第二项 主控与被控集成安装
安装
输入2 回车 进入安装环节 如果你的母鸡在国内,那么下载预装镜像可能有点慢,坐等即可。
安装

第二步-开心

安装完之后,我们进行开心。引用来源
首先vi /etc/hosts在HOSTS附加如下 SolusVM Enterprise (NOC)

150.95.9.225 soluslabs.com
150.95.9.225 www.soluslabs.com
150.95.9.225 licensing1.soluslabs.net
150.95.9.225 licensing2.soluslabs.net
150.95.9.225 licensing3.soluslabs.net
150.95.9.225 licensing4.soluslabs.net
150.95.9.225 licensing5.soluslabs.net
150.95.9.225 licensing6.soluslabs.net

然后执行如下命令

iptables -I INPUT -s 94.0.0.0/8 -j DROP
service iptables save
service iptables restart

执行后我们打开https://IP:5656/admincp (无视SSL证书)
web
我们在这里随便输入点什么,然后点SAVE,即开心完成。

第三步-配置节点

IP
在这里进行IP配置,一定要按照图上的配置。
IP
点击进入。
IP
按上图配置,保存。
Plan
在这里进行Plan设置,相信大家都可以看懂。

第四步-NAT配置

回到SSH vi /etc/modprobe.d/openvz.conf 将最后的1改为0 然后执行reboot
用vi编辑器新建一个文件,然后把https://github.com/qq2312890354/addnat.sh/blob/master/addnat.sh的脚本内容复制进入,记得把画圈的替换为你自己的网卡名。
SH
替换完毕后,执行ip addr
IP ADDR
记录下主网卡IP,接下来要用。
执行
执行刚才的脚本,询问IP,输入主网卡IP(如果为内网IP 那么也要输入内网IP)
网段填入1
这时我们的NAT就配置好了,端口规则如下:

  • SSH端口:10.0.1.X 61X(不足五位用0补齐)
  • NAT端口:10.0.1.X 1X0-1X9 (不足五位用0补齐)

网卡IP一定要写主网卡IP,是内网写内网,是外网写外网,不要擅自决定写啥,亲身经历得出。。。

结束

配置到这里就结束了,新建VM的方法是先添加客户,再创建VM,你已经到这一步了,我就简单给你演示下吧。
客户
像这样,填。
VM
像这样,新建VM。
结果
像这样,是结果,端口可以按照上面的方法推算出来,很简单。

最后

hahah,开VM很简单嘛,用不了多久,人手一个IDC不是梦辣!(大雾)

最后修改:2020 年 07 月 04 日 08 : 07 PM
如果觉得我的文章对你有用,请随意赞赏